Guacamolito 0 Posted August 18, 2025 Posted August 18, 2025 Hi, I'm testing the cinema intros feature for the first time and i really like it. BUT, i feel like all the point of this feature is immerse ourselves like we are at a movie theater. Drop your phone, shut up, enjoy, here is a movie trailer for you and 3, 2, 1, here is your film ! Beautiful ! Love it. And here it is, the film backdrop popping out of nowhere for a fraction of second because i guess Emby has to load the very beginning of the film. Understandable but it break the very same immersion we just built. I feel like it would be so much better to pre-load the start of the film while intros are playing or at least display a solid black color instead of the backdrop in order to fake a clean cut. If it is possible to avoid that i would love to know how, if not well this is a feature request i guess. P.S. : As English isn't my first language I apologize for any mistakes.
